Online coaches can be your ultimate resource. When you hire someone to help you on your fitness journey they can help with:


  • being a source of motivation to get you off your butt and in the gym.


  • writing up a high level program for you that will get you results so you don’t have to go through the headache of looking up programs that might not even work.


  • being there to answer any questions along the way so that you have the peace of mind knowing you are being taken care of.


When it comes to online coaches, like any other business, not all of them are exactly the same. Some have certain specialties. Some sell different types of services. And not all of their intake and coaching processes are exactly the same.


But if you were curious, here’s an idea of what you might expect from an online trainer.


This is how I personally take on new clients and the process they go through to get started on their path to achieving their personal goals.


1. You fill out a coaching application

This application takes care of all the details that help me to guide you as best I can with nutrition and to write you up a program that will help you reach your goals. It also covers what kind of equipment you have available to you. If you have an entire gym at your disposal, or you have no equipment at all, it is possible to write you a workout program that gets you great results.


2. We have a Zoom meeting

During this meeting we get the chance to meet face to face. We first start by going over exactly what your goals are. Once that is done I do a brief movement assessment. This ensures that I do not give you exercises that may injure you or that you are not yet ready for. After that we sit down and map out a plan to get you in the right direction. This is where we talk about short term goals, habit setting, and answer any other questions.


3. You track your workouts and nutrition throughout the week


One of the ways that we communicate is through you tracking certain things throughout the week. This includes logging what weights you use in the gym and tracking your nutritional habits. This way I am able to get an honest look at how your week went. Depending on how you did we can make any changes needed or we can see what works well and keep improving.


4. Weekly Check Ins


Once a week I send out a brief questionnaire that takes about 5 minutes to fill out. It covers different aspects of your week that can contribute to your success on the program. I then will respond as quickly as possible so that you are all set up for the next week.


Even though I only send out the check in once a week, I personally love to get multiple emails throughout the week to keep the line of communication open. And with the way I run my service, you get 24/7 email access so that if anything comes up you can always reach me.


This is just a basic outline of how I personally work with clients. But, again, all coaches do it a little differently.


Regardless of the differences in the process, having an online coach can be an extremely beneficial resource. The experience could honestly be life changing. A little bit of accountability, encouragement, and guidance goes a long way.
